Term Name: 5-(2-hydroxyethyl)-4-methylthiazole
Synonyms: 2-(4-methyl-1,3-thiazol-5-yl)ethanol, 4-methyl-5-(2'-hydroxyethyl)-thiazole, 4-Methyl-5-(2-hydroxyethyl)-thiazole, 4-Methyl-5-thiazolethanol, 5-(2-Hydroxyethyl)-4-methylthiazole, Hemineurine
Definition: A 1,3-thiazole that is thiazole substituted by a methyl group at position 4 and a 2-hydroxyethyl group at position 5.
